Understanding Your Project Needs
What Sort of Work Are You Planning?
Before you also consider employing a contractor, it's crucial to clearly describe your task demands. Are you trying to find small repair services or comprehensive improvements? Different contractors concentrate on numerous types of work:
- General Contractors: Look after entire projects. Specialty Contractors: Focus on particular locations like pipes or electric work. Design-Build Firms: Handle both style and construction.
Understanding the extent of your task will certainly help you identify which type of professional best fits your needs.

Getting Estimates
https://book.housecallpro.com/book/HSR-Home-Services/e3a415194b194b1a91888361dd6b6bcaWhy Are Numerous Estimates Necessary?
Obtaining a number of estimates enables you to compare prices and solutions provided by various service providers properly. Nevertheless, make certain that each price quote includes detailed failures for transparency.
What Ought to An Estimate Include?
- Labor costs Material costs Timeline for completion Payment schedules Warranty information
By contrasting these facets across quotes, you'll acquire understandings right into that uses worth as opposed to just lower prices.
Contract Negotiation
Understanding Your Contract Terms
Once you have actually selected a professional, discussing the contract terms becomes vital in making sure clearness throughout the task's implementation.
Key components consist of:
Scope of Work: Plainly specify what is consisted of in the project. Payment Schedule: Describe when repayments are due based upon milestones achieved. Completion Dates: Specify timelines for different stages of work. Change Orders: Go over exactly how modifications will certainly be taken care of if they develop throughout construction.
Being explicit concerning these terms helps avoid disagreements later on on!
Importance Of Composed Agreements
Do not count exclusively on spoken contracts! Guarantee everything is recorded in creating; this secures both events and supplies option if conflicts take place later on down the line.
